Minutes — Management Meeting, Revised Commission Scheme

Present: board members of Draymont Corp plus CFO V. Hallings. Revised sales-commission scheme approved in principle. Base rate unchanged; accelerator kicks in at 110% of quota. Caps removed for strategic accounts in the Orvale region. Clawback period extended to two quarters. Payroll changes effective next cycle. V. Hallings to circulate final tables within ten days. Objections recorded: none. The item appended below is confidential to the board and must not be circulated.

confidential, kajof-tahof: The pricing group signed off on a budget of $491.8 million for Project Casvan.

- [ ] Verify the Corvette ledger's conversion module rounds half-to-even at exactly four decimal places before truncating to the target currency's minor unit; any deviation compounds across the Marlowe settlement batch. Reviewer must confirm test coverage for sub-cent remainders. Once verified, unseal the ceremony envelope and record the recovery passphrase, which reads as follows:

vault phrase of bagaf-kajeg = jorath-feniel-briir-siliel-ralix

Hey Priya — handing off the bulk-edit work on the Ledgerkite admin table. Multi-row status changes now go through the batch endpoint, so the old per-row PATCH loop is gone. One gotcha: edits over 500 rows get queued, not applied inline, and the UI doesn't say so yet. For the release build, make sure staging carries these settings.

deployment values, fahap-hahaf:
[casdor]
port = 9200
region = south-2
host = casdor.qirvanworks.corp
timeout_ms = 3000
retries = 4

CI failure on the Quillgate audit-log viewer is not flaky. The pagination snapshot test breaks whenever the fixture clock crosses midnight UTC, because the viewer groups entries by local day. Pin the fixture clock in `test_setup` and regenerate snapshots; do not bump retries. Also note the viewer build now requires the schema bundle from the Ledgerline pipeline, so a stale cache will 404 the fixtures. Clear the runner cache first, then rerun. The failing run's trace token is pasted just under this note.

build token for kagaf-hahof: htk14_9d3d4d26d7d8de